Incident Summary:

03/08/2015: Assailants detonated an explosive device and opened fire on police personnel responding to earlier attacks in Sitio Kipolot, Palacapao village, Bukidnon province, Philippines. At least six police officers were injured in the attack. This was one of three related attacks in Palacapao on this date.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, source attributed it to the New People's Army (NPA).
